Subject: DR drill — Quillstream encoding detector

Team, next Thursday we simulate total loss of the Quillstream service that detects encodings on uploaded text files. Maintainers should restore from the cold snapshot and verify UTF-16 and legacy codepage samples decode correctly. Restoring the snapshot vault requires the drill passphrase, which for this exercise is documented directly below this line.

unlock words, hahip-baduf: holwyn-istath-julvan

## Artifact signing — Ledgerbee billing worker

Quick primer for support: the billing worker ships via blue-green deploys, so there are always two environments and only one takes traffic. Every artifact is signed before it's allowed into either slot, which is why a "bad signature" alert means the deploy never went live. To verify an artifact yourself, use the key below.

release key, fajef-kajeg: bky19_LdLu6Ne6FLi8he2c24d

Handover — Fri evening

Lift maintenance this weekend, both cars in the Wrenmoor Tower. Contractors from Haleford Lifts on site Sat 07:00–16:00, Sun mornings only. Lift B out of service the whole time; post the signs by 06:30. Stairwell doors stay unlocked on floors 2–6. Goods lift is fallback for deliveries.

To release the goods lift for them, use the code below.

door code, tagef-bajop: bdg-SB-7

### v2.14.3

- Fixed session-token refresh bug in Brindlegate auth service: concurrent refresh requests could mint two valid tokens, leaving one unrevoked. Refresh is now serialized per session with single-use rotation. Regression test added; prior tokens force-expired on deploy. Security-relevant change, reviewed internally. Accountable engineer for this fix is named below.

approver of yawig-yajef = Briius Jorix

**Vendor note: Inkmill markdown pipeline**

Rendering for Parchway docs is outsourced to Inkmill under an annual contract, renewing each March. They handle sanitization and PDF export; we own the upload queue. SLA: 4-hour response on rendering failures. Escalate only after two failed retries. Their support desk is reachable at the address below.

billing contact of hahaf-baguf = zorael.tammir.jorius@sivrelhq.internal